Famous Crimes #7 is referenced in Fredric Wertham’s “Seduction of the Innocent” (SOTI) in the text on page 44.Wertham describes his experience with Famous Crimes #7 as follows “Once in the waiting room of the Clinic I saw a little boy crouched over a comic book, oblivious to everything around him. In passing I could see the title of the story he was reading. Big capital letters spelled out T A R Z A N. Surely, I thought, the adventures of Tarzan are harmless enough for juveniles of any age. But I was mislead, as many parents no doubt are. When I looked at this comic book later I found on the inside cover the picture of a man tied up in an agonizing position – a man ‘found dead in a Dallas park, his hands tied behind him and two bullets in his worthless carcass’; another man shot in the back as he is thrown out of a care (‘Get out, ya stinking rat!’) – and more of the same. Tarzan was not the whole title of the story I had seen the boy in the waiting room reading. There was a subtitle ‘The Wyoming Killer’ and two other headings, ‘From Police Files’ and ‘A True Crime Story.’ The story was not about Tarzan, but about a hero who robbed a bank and shot five men to death.”
